Na man totally different things. Your are thinking of SRS which is the airbag stuff. ABS is just brakes. I believe all you need to do would be remove the Airbag steering wheel, the SRS 'brain' (it's under the dash on the driver's side i believe), and all the sensors and harness for the air bags. It will all unplug from the main harness. You shouldn't have to cut anything to get that stuff out. I removed my cruise control stuff completely from the car and it wasn't too bad. Didn't have to cut any wires. It's pretty straight forward overall and if you have a bentley manual, I believe it covers all of the airbag stuff in there.
